Meeting notes — Facilities planning, item 6: key-card stock for the new Larchbrook site. Two hundred blank cards and the encoder ribbon arrived from Veyrath Systems and are locked in the supplies cabinet. Count and initial the inventory slip before packing. Veyrath's courier collects the sealed box Friday. The box is released only once the courier states this phrase:

handover note for tadug-yaguf: the aldath pelwyn courier leaves the casox norwyn briix silok zorok kasdor aldion quenox ledger at gate 2653 under passcode 959015

**Ticket: Vault locked during Corvette-to-Hemlock build migration**

While migrating the Lanternfish project to the Hemlock hermetic build system, the legacy secrets vault locked itself after three failed fetches — the old fetcher passed a stale token format that Hemlock's sandbox mangles. Future maintainers: don't retry blindly; the vault hard-locks after five attempts. The fix is to unseal it manually once, then re-register the fetcher. Unseal the vault with the passphrase below.

unlock words, hahip-baduf: holwyn-istath-julvan

Weekly eng sync — Splitgate assignment service. Bucketing drift fixed; hash salt now versioned per experiment. Sticky assignments verified across the Larkspur rollout. Open issue: stale cache on the Quillwood edge nodes causes ~0.3% crossover; mitigation shipping Thursday. Dashboards updated, alert thresholds tightened. Next: deprecate legacy cohort API by end of quarter. Questions on assignment semantics should go to the service owner named below.

approver of tagag-yawip = Sorax Ulawyn

# Break-Glass: Catalog Cache Invalidation

Scope: the Pinrow product catalog at Veldstone Retail. If stale prices persist after a purge and the Hollowmere invalidation queue is wedged, use break-glass to flush the edge tier directly. Contractors: get verbal sign-off from the catalog lead first. Steps: open the Hollowmere admin shell, select emergency-flush, confirm the tenant, and run it once — repeated flushes thrash the origin. Access is logged and expires after 20 minutes. Unseal the admin shell with the passphrase below.

recovery phrase for kahop-tajog: istix-casvan